Transaction 708bfcc033f3f49bdf35748a94c29c99afd2fba0681f78eb2596722003a88295
1 Input
2 Outputs
- 708bfcc033f3f49bdf35748a94c29c99afd2fba0681f78eb2596722003a88295:0
- 708bfcc033f3f49bdf35748a94c29c99afd2fba0681f78eb2596722003a88295:1
value 424432500
address 1MUzj2nk1TPurX6wfMUrqsNn16HU2sgGcB
value 2729938459
address 12rxDmRYiWb7JgTv3ZfJi7bHx5gbEGvc21